Commit Graph

116 Commits

Author SHA1 Message Date
Mark Crane d09f04272a Uncomment the provision_write include 2014-01-29 21:34:01 +00:00
Mark Crane 4012d9d9bb Get rid of the names in the Grandstream select type (mode) because the modes to actions are not consistent. 2014-01-28 11:35:57 +00:00
Mark Crane 94014cb935 Show only the correct vendor on the device edit page. 2014-01-28 11:03:05 +00:00
Mark Crane 35d0d4eb27 Fix the grandstream select values in the device edit page. 2014-01-28 10:44:56 +00:00
Mark Crane 4bedac5c92 Add grandstream options to device edit. 2014-01-28 07:56:03 +00:00
Mark Crane eeb1097fd5 add message to devices app_languages.php 2014-01-20 20:04:24 +00:00
Mark Crane 004ee3e990 Make the device edit page one form. Adding a new record or editing anything and then press save will save everything. 2014-01-20 18:00:45 +00:00
Mark Crane 6ab865958c Device Edit, Use the new ORM for the database access, adjus the column width of some of the form elements, structure the POST into a two dimensional array, remove the submit from the array. Move the database requests before the content rather than inside the content. 2014-01-20 09:34:04 +00:00
Mark Crane 1479d157ca Add static to the device method to get rid of strict message. 2014-01-14 01:50:19 +00:00
Mark Crane 80a1fb3284 Add a 'save' button to the top of the device edit page. 2014-01-12 06:38:28 +00:00
Mark Crane 9709c9f1c4 When editing a device return to the edit page rather than the list. 2014-01-08 20:07:02 +00:00
Mark Crane bf69ce48a9 Fix the back button on the device key edit page. And fix disabled select option. 2014-01-08 19:54:33 +00:00
Mark Crane 888b9fba15 Add 0 option to the select list for line number on the device edit page. 2014-01-05 10:42:11 +00:00
Mark Crane 3fbcc7580d Add 0 option to the select list for line number on the device edit page. 2014-01-05 10:39:40 +00:00
Mark Crane a3c935228f Add device key extensions to the device keys table. 2014-01-04 04:40:40 +00:00
Mark Crane d92e0211a9 Add device key extension for yealink. Add a device class. 2014-01-03 23:11:42 +00:00
Mark Crane 08c772cde4 Add device_key_line 2014-01-03 08:05:46 +00:00
Mark Crane a5a56a95a6 Add an order by to the devices page so that the position doesn't move around. 2014-01-02 23:20:15 +00:00
Mark Crane 3149cd2665 Add a select list for all yealink types. 2014-01-02 01:14:43 +00:00
Mark Crane ca7d7244f3 Fix the insert for the new field. 2013-12-29 06:55:39 +00:00
Mark Crane ad17a3e5dc Add the missing column to device edit. 2013-12-29 06:49:28 +00:00
Mark Crane 2d889a0e8d Add Device Key Category. 2013-12-29 06:47:25 +00:00
Mark Crane 5d01e8f176 Add the license to the device keys. 2013-12-29 05:20:51 +00:00
Mark Crane 477f10b0dd Remove test code on the device key edit. 2013-12-29 05:00:56 +00:00
Mark Crane 9f2f19ea16 Require the device_setting_add permission to see the settings on the devices page. Require the device_key_add or device_key_edit permission to see the the key information on the devices page. 2013-12-27 20:52:38 +00:00
Mark Crane eb8b59ddb6 Accounts -> Devices, adjust the width of the lines, keys, and settings. 2013-12-21 16:41:44 +00:00
Mark Crane 7b125bbbc5 Fix provisioning device line edit account for sip expire and port fields are numeric. 2013-12-19 21:55:45 +00:00
Mark Crane 399a43804d Add a new table v_device_keys which is used to assign the buttons to lines, blf, park and more. Also add sip port, sip transport and register expires to device lines. 2013-12-17 16:19:54 +00:00
Mark Crane 5b2a187bc7 Move device settings into device edit simplify the interface and make it faster to setup provisioning. 2013-12-10 15:05:16 +00:00
Mark Crane b5c09c7934 After adding or editing a device setting redirect back to device_edit.php. 2013-12-10 14:00:54 +00:00
Mark Crane 5e794bd6b8 Correct the name of the device setting edit php file. 2013-12-10 13:56:48 +00:00
Mark Crane 89758bce16 Correct the name of the device setting delete php file. 2013-12-10 13:56:10 +00:00
Mark Crane 5f02276930 Remove provision device_extensions table in favor of the device_lines table. Set the mac address, line, and template from extensio edit php file. 2013-11-26 10:14:38 +00:00
Mark Crane baaec45d10 Provisioning fix device_setting_category and device_setting_subcategory schema definitions. 2013-11-24 00:35:02 +00:00
Matt Putnam 8a86537b7a 2013-11-14 02:16:11 +00:00
Matt Putnam 04a76589ce Added device_settings.php, device_settings_delete.php, and device_settings_edit.php as well as modified app_config.php and app_languages.php to include the new labels and permissions. 2013-11-14 01:48:37 +00:00
Nuno Miguel Reis 24dabf4a1c language translations for pt-pt and some other minor fixes and updates 2013-10-17 22:06:01 +00:00
Nuno Miguel Reis 184ec05020 changed single quote to double quotes everywhere 2013-10-01 11:35:07 +00:00
Mark Crane a43c8f892d Correct the tabbing by replacing the spaces with tabs. Replace some of the single quotes with double qoutes and keep the fr-ca translations. 2013-09-30 16:21:08 +00:00
Mark Crane 0955da65ba Fix a few things in app_config.php leaving fr-ca and changing some of the single quotes to double quotes. 2013-09-30 16:16:32 +00:00
Philippe Rioual f0489b418f repaired previous errors inserted in r4614 : reinserted 'de-de' instead 'de' and correct files. keeps fr-ca to report in app_config.php files 2013-09-30 15:22:35 +00:00
Philippe Rioual 9ce5b02701 added missing french translations and changed fr to fr-fr in all app_languages.php and app_config.php files. 2013-09-30 13:19:40 +00:00
Mark Crane 187bc9dbeb Add permissions for every table (view, add, edit, and delete). Important change to increase security on the REST API and will be beneficial for more detailed control of permissions. 2013-09-25 20:23:10 +00:00
Mark Crane 850ff7b0db Change fr to fr-fr and de to de-de. 2013-09-17 20:02:19 +00:00
Nuno Miguel Reis cfc37a8910 new changes to group_permissions/menu logic 2013-09-17 19:06:44 +00:00
Mark Crane f077840883 Move the French translations into the development branch.
Translation work done thanks to by bhouba for his work on the translations.
2013-09-13 21:04:53 +00:00
Mark Crane 962fc99515 Fix the database app_config array on several of teh app_config file array. 2013-09-13 09:39:57 +00:00
Mark Crane ea4e824fd5 Added ['type'] so that it is applied as $field['key']['type'] so that it is uniform across all app_config.php files. 2013-09-10 23:06:41 +00:00
Mark Crane 6da2c3734c Update the references for header.php and footer.php files to point the resources directory. 2013-07-06 06:29:50 +00:00
Mark Crane 52628c713c Rename and move persistformvar.php to the resources directory. 2013-07-06 06:21:12 +00:00
Mark Crane ffffea0710 Change the path for includes/require.php to the resources directory. 2013-07-06 06:03:27 +00:00
Mark Crane a6e289ed5d Change includes/checkauth.php to resources/check_auth.php. 2013-07-06 05:50:55 +00:00
Mark Crane 9e1d856ec4 Change the paging results from 10 to 150 on devices. Remove the duplicate template select on devices. 2013-06-10 16:39:09 +00:00
Mark Crane 673739d6e3 Allow lines to be added when a device is created. 2013-06-09 21:06:12 +00:00
Mark Crane cd207440a3 Update devices to provide customizable line information. 2013-06-09 20:46:14 +00:00
Mark Crane 3723001194 Move the references to includes/templates to resources/templates. 2013-06-09 05:05:17 +00:00
Mark Crane df48067467 Add the translation framework to devices and add ability to show which extensions are assigned to a device. 2013-05-23 08:18:12 +00:00
Mark Crane 189ae6f377 Copy the translations French and Spanish translations into the dev branch. 2013-05-13 00:50:43 +00:00
Mark Crane 36779b6118 Add option to for domain based provisioning template directory.
Example: provision/domain_name
2013-04-29 14:45:25 +00:00
Mark Crane dd14687991 Correct the permission for device delete. 2013-04-09 23:26:20 +00:00
Mark Crane cac9c03279 Update the delete link. 2013-04-09 22:51:36 +00:00
Mark Crane 648ef006cc Rename the hardware phones to devices. 2013-03-20 16:53:37 +00:00
Mark Crane 3ce7d717ca Rename the file to devices.php. 2013-03-20 16:22:44 +00:00
Mark Crane db3e007a12 hardware_phone_edit.php renamed to device_edit.php 2013-03-20 16:21:24 +00:00
Mark Crane 439902d3eb Rename the file. 2013-03-20 16:20:52 +00:00
Mark Crane 7c7c475a16 Rename hardward_phones to devices 2013-03-20 16:20:15 +00:00